National Milk Day – Nov 26th

National Milk Day is observed on 26th November of each year.

On November 26th of each year, the nation observes National Milk Day. And on that day, it is emphasised how important milk is and how beneficial it is to the body. In order to raise awareness of the value and necessity of milk in human life, this special day is observed. Furthermore, milk is the very first meal that a baby consumes after birth. It also turns into the staple meal or beverage consumed for the rest of one’s life.

History and Importance of National Milk Day:

In 2014, the National Dairy Development Board (NDDB), the Indian Dairy Association (IDA), and 22 state-level milk factions concluded to jointly choose November 26 as the day to honour Dr Verghese Kurien, who is regarded as the founder of India’s White Revolution. As a result, the first National Milk Day was celebrated on November 26, 2014.

In India, Dr Verghese Kurien is regarded as the “Father of the White Revolution.” He was a social entrepreneur who oversaw Operation Flood, which grew to be the nation’s biggest agricultural dairy development system. India went from having a shortage of milk to becoming the largest milk manufacturer in the world as a result of this operation.

Furthermore, Kurien contributed significantly to the creation of Amul. The local service cartel was broken by Amul about 65 years ago, which paved the way for Gujarat’s dairy cooperative industries to advance. He presided over the Gujarat Cooperative Milk Marketing Federation from 1973 to 2006. (GCMMF).

Benefits of drinking milk:
Milk Is An Excellent Source of Calcium

Let’s start by stating the obvious. Calcium does more than just prevent brittleness in your bones. According to a Havard study, calcium also significantly contributes to your heart’s ability to physically pump blood by enabling muscle contraction. Every time you slash yourself, it helps the blood clot, attempting to prevent you from dying from excessive bleeding. It contributes significantly to the wellness of your teeth, nails, and hair in addition to strengthening your bones.
